Chandigarh, November 4

A delegation of the Joint Action Committee (JAC), UT Chandigarh, met Director Public Instructions DPI (S) Kamlesh Kuma, seeking immediate relieving of Shekhar Chandar, headmaster at GMSH in Sector 26, who is on deputation from Punjab.

The committee members informed that the headmaster had already availed the extension of two years as per the Punjab government rules up to October 31, 2014.

The members alleged that despite the DEO Chandigarh Administration relieving the headmaster, he was still occupying the post, which is illegal and unjustified.

Swarn Singh Kamboj, RTI activist-cum-president, UT Cadre Educational Employees Union, Chandigarh, claimed that though the headmaster had retired on October 31, and the department had already issued his relieving order the same day, he continued to serve on the same post.

Till date, Chandar has been marking his attendance while defying all orders of the department, he alleged.

Kamboj said, “How can a government employee, who has been issued relieving orders, join duty without getting the joining instructions”.

The delegation of JAC members, including Bhag Singh Kairon, convener, appealed to the DPI to relieve the headmaster immediately. The members claimed that the DPI had assured them that Chandar would be relieved at the earliest.
